Zhou Jiyi, grandson of Chinese writer and literary scholar Zhou Zuoren (1885-1967), speaks during an interview in Beijing, China, on March 25, 2015, about letters sent to Zuoren by Japanese writers including Junichiro Tanizaki and Naoya Shiga. (Kyodo) ==Kyodo
